[arch-commits] Commit in python-anytree/trunk (PKGBUILD)

Jan Steffens heftig at archlinux.org
Sat Feb 23 15:25:56 UTC 2019


    Date: Saturday, February 23, 2019 @ 15:25:54
  Author: heftig
Revision: 346715

2.6.0-2

Modified:
  python-anytree/trunk/PKGBUILD

----------+
 PKGBUILD |   39 +++++++++++----------------------------
 1 file changed, 11 insertions(+), 28 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2019-02-23 15:25:12 UTC (rev 346714)
+++ PKGBUILD	2019-02-23 15:25:54 UTC (rev 346715)
@@ -1,46 +1,29 @@
 # Maintainer: Jan Alexander Steffens (heftig) <jan.steffens at gmail.com>
 
-pkgbase=python-anytree
-pkgname=(python-anytree python2-anytree)
+pkgname=python-anytree
 pkgver=2.6.0
-pkgrel=1
+pkgrel=2
 pkgdesc="Powerful and Lightweight Python Tree Data Structure"
 url="https://anytree.readthedocs.io/"
 arch=(any)
 license=(Apache)
-makedepends=(python{,2}-{six,setuptools} git)
+depends=(python-six)
+makedepends=(python-setuptools git)
 _commit=775477e206a75e697983e70dae6372b5a7e42dcf  # tags/2.6.0
-source=("$pkgbase::git+https://github.com/c0fec0de/anytree#commit=$_commit")
+source=("$pkgname::git+https://github.com/c0fec0de/anytree#commit=$_commit")
 sha256sums=('SKIP')
 
 pkgver() {
-  cd $pkgbase
+  cd $pkgname
   git describe --tags | sed 's/^v//;s/-/+/g'
 }
 
-prepare() {
-  cp -a $pkgbase python2
-  cp -a $pkgbase python3
-}
-
 build() {
-  cd python3
-  python3 setup.py build
-
-  cd ../python2
-  python2 setup.py build
+  cd $pkgname
+  python setup.py build
 }
 
-package_python-anytree() {
-  depends=(python-six)
-
-  cd python3
-  python3 setup.py install --root="$pkgdir" --optimize=1 --skip-build
+package() {
+  cd $pkgname
+  python setup.py install --root="$pkgdir" --optimize=1 --skip-build
 }
-
-package_python2-anytree() {
-  depends=(python2-six)
-
-  cd python2
-  python2 setup.py install --root="$pkgdir" --optimize=1 --skip-build
-}



More information about the arch-commits mailing list